'I'm like falling asleep and...': Why Trump picked ‘Epic Fury’ from 20 names for the Iran operation

Trump says US strike on Iran was conducted under “Operation Epic Fury,” targeting Iranian missile and drone capabilities.

US president says he selected the name “Epic Fury” for the military operation targeting Iranian missile, drone and maritime capabilities.

US President Donald Trump said the United States carried out military strikes on Iran under an operation named “Epic Fury,” stating that the action was intended to eliminate threats posed by what he described as a “terrorist regime.”

Speaking at a gathering, Trump said he selected the name for the operation from a list presented by US military generals. According to ANI, the US president said the military had suggested around 20 possible names.

“I saw ‘Epic Fury’ and said, ‘I like that name,’” Trump said, describing the process. “They gave me like 20 names, and I'm like falling asleep, I didn't like any of them. Then I see Epic Fury. I said, ‘I like that name. I like that name,’” he added.

Trump said the operation was successful and that US forces achieved their objectives rapidly.

“It is only good if you win, you know, you can only, and we've won, let me tell you, we've won,” he said, according to ANI. “You know, you never like to say too early you won, we won, we won, but in the first hour it was over.”

The US president described the action as a limited military move aimed at countering threats from Iran.

“We did an excursion, you know what an excursion is? We had to take a little trip to get rid of some evil, very evil people. It should have been done,” Trump said, according to ANI.

Trump also alleged that Iran had long posed threats across the Middle East and claimed US strikes caught Iranian forces off guard.

“They don't know what the hell hit them… They got hit by the American military… They didn't expect anything like this,” he said.

Trump said the US operation aimed to weaken Iran’s ability to launch attacks by targeting missile and drone capabilities.

Speaking to reporters earlier during a visit to the Thermo Fisher Scientific facility in Cincinnati, Trump said the strikes were designed to neutralise Iranian missile and drone infrastructure.

“Well, it's both. It's both. It's an excursion that will keep us out of a war, and the war is going to be — for them, it's a war; for us, it's turned out to be easier than we thought,” Trump said, according to ANI.

He also claimed that US forces had moved quickly to limit Iran’s missile launch capabilities.

“But think of it, they had thousands of missiles, 7–8 thousand missiles. We got many of them before they got to launch,” Trump said.

Trump added that US forces were also targeting Iranian drone manufacturing facilities and maritime assets linked to potential mining activities.

The strikes come amid an escalating military confrontation between the United States and Iran that began with US attacks on Iranian targets earlier this year.

In a speech announcing the initial strikes, Trump outlined several military objectives for the campaign, including destroying Iran’s missile infrastructure, dismantling naval capabilities, preventing Iranian proxy groups from destabilising the region, and ensuring Iran does not obtain a nuclear weapon.

Since then, US and Israeli forces have conducted a series of strikes on Iranian military infrastructure, including missile facilities and naval assets, as the conflict has expanded across the region.
